Senior Donor Relations OfficerInternational Human Services NonprofitBoston Area - Remote

Salary Range: $80,000 to $90,000 per year, with potential flexibility based on experience

Terrific Senior Donor Relations Officer position with an organization focused on transforming the lives of tens of thousands of the most vulnerable children. This role will collaborate with the President and CEO on major gifts fundraising. The Senior Donor Relations Officer will manage the full fundraising lifecycle for a portfolio of donors on the East Coast, with an initial focus on the Boston area.

Responsibilities:
  • Manage and grow a portfolio of donors and prospects capable of giving $5,000+
  • Identify, cultivate, solicit, and steward donors
  • Foster strong relationships with donors and supporters
  • Develop and execute multi-year fundraising strategies
  • Contribute significantly to a team goal of $1.9 million annually
  • Expand the reach of fundraising efforts throughout the East Coast over time
  • Maintain donor records in Salesforce
  • Attend organization events, as needed
  • Travel to meet with donors and prospects, as needed
Qualifications:
  • Approximately 3 to 5+ years of major gifts fundraising experience
  • Bachelor's degree preferred
  • Demonstrated track record of securing major gifts
  • Ability to connect with donors while conveying the organization's mission and work
  • Self-starter and capable of working autonomously
  • Driver's License required
  • Ability to travel domestically and internationally, as needed, most travel will be local in the Boston area
